Made IT Easy: Step-by-Step Installation And Maintenance of OpenSIPS
In today’s digital landscape, Voice over Internet Protocol (VoIP) technology is a cornerstone of modern communication infrastructure. At its forefront stands OpenSIPS, a stalwart SIP server renowned for its resilience and adaptability in enabling seamless real-time communications. As businesses pivot towards VoIP solutions to meet their evolving communication demands, the significance of comprehending the installation and maintenance nuances of OpenSIPS cannot be overstated. This guide serves as a beacon, illuminating the intricate steps required to deploy and sustain OpenSIPS and ensure that businesses can navigate its capabilities with confidence and clarity.
As the heartbeat of contemporary communication beats the rhythm of VoIP, OpenSIPS emerges as a beacon of reliability and innovation. With enterprises increasingly embracing VoIP solutions as a cornerstone of their operations, mastering OpenSIPS’ installation and maintenance procedures becomes indispensable. Through this comprehensive guide, we embark on a journey to demystify the intricate processes of setting up and nurturing OpenSIPS, equipping businesses with the tools and insights to unleash their full potential. Let us navigate the realm of OpenSIPS together, empowering organizations to harness the power of real-time communication with precision and proficiency.
Understanding OpenSIPS:
OpenSIPS, short for Open Session Initiation Protocol Server, is a powerful intermediary for handling SIP signaling, registration, and other crucial aspects of VoIP communication. Its modular architecture and extensive feature set make it a preferred choice for enterprises seeking scalable and customizable SIP solutions.
Step-by-Step Installation Guide:
1. Prerequisites:
Before diving into the installation process, ensure your system meets the following prerequisites:
- Linux-based operating system (e.g., Ubuntu, CentOS)
- Adequate system resources (CPU, RAM, storage)
- Basic familiarity with the command line interface
2. Installation:
Follow these steps to install OpenSIPS on your system:
Update Package Repositories:
Run `sudo apt update` (for Ubuntu) or `sudo yum update` (for CentOS) to update package repositories.
Install Dependencies:
Install necessary dependencies using `sudo apt install` or `sudo yum install,` including libraries and development tools required by OpenSIPS.
Download OpenSIPS:
Obtain the latest version of OpenSIPS from the official website or repository.
Compile and Install:
Navigate to the downloaded directory, compile the source code using `make,` and install OpenSIPS using `make install.`
3. Configuration:
After installation, configure OpenSIPS to suit your specific requirements:
- Modify the installation directory’s main configuration file (`opensips.cfg`).
- Customize SIP listening ports, database connections, routing logic, and other parameters based on your network architecture and preferences.
- Test the configuration using the `opensipsctl` command-line tool to ensure proper functionality and address errors or warnings.
Maintenance Best Practices:
Maintaining OpenSIPS involves proactive monitoring, periodic updates, and troubleshooting as needed. Here are some best practices to ensure the smooth operation of your OpenSIPS deployment:
- Regularly monitor system performance, SIP traffic, and resource utilization using monitoring tools or built-in OpenSIPS modules.
- Stay updated with the latest releases and security patches the OpenSIPS community provides to address vulnerabilities and enhance functionality.
- Implement automated backup procedures to safeguard critical configuration files, databases, and call logs against data loss or corruption.
- Establish a testing environment to simulate changes or updates before applying them to the production environment, minimizing the risk of service disruption.
Conclusion:
In conclusion, mastering the installation and maintenance of OpenSIPS empowers businesses to leverage VoIP technology efficiently, streamline communication workflows, and deliver superior customer experiences. By following the step-by-step guide outlined above and adopting best practices for maintenance, you can unlock the full potential of OpenSIPS and stay ahead in today’s dynamic communications landscape.
For further assistance or inquiries regarding OpenSIPS installation, configuration, or customization, please get in touch with our team of experts.
Ready to supercharge your communication infrastructure with OpenSIPS? Contact us today to explore tailored solutions and unleash the power of real-time SIP communications for your business.